Форум программистов, компьютерный форум CyberForum.ru

С++ бинарные файлы - C++

Войти
Регистрация
Восстановить пароль
Другие темы раздела
C++ Стек на основе динамического массива http://www.cyberforum.ru/cpp-beginners/thread218987.html
Надо написать стек на основе динамического массива. Как выделить память под новый элемент? template <typename T> void Stack<T>::AddElem(T item) { size++; mas = new T; mas = item;
C++ Найти максимальный элемент матрицы Дана прямоугольная матрица, все элементы которой различны. в заштрихованной области, где min – минимальный элемент матрицы. http://www.cyberforum.ru/cpp-beginners/thread218983.html
Подправить программу, где-то ошибся) C++
Не выводит седловые точки #include<conio.h> #include<stdio.h> void main(void) { int i,j, a, imin, imax,m,n,max,min,f; clrscr();
в чем ошибка? C++
делаю задания по книге. вот код #include <iostream.h> main() { int a, b; cout << "vvedite 2 chisla";
C++ Обратная матрица, IndexOf http://www.cyberforum.ru/cpp-beginners/thread218970.html
нужно на vs2005 c++ сделать 2 вещи: 1)обратная матрица 2)Indexof чем проще написано тем лучше, главное чтобы норм компилировалось. ребят помогите,горит!!....
C++ Найти количество нулевых элементов массива и заменить их на найденное значение Задание: Найти количество нулевых элементов и заменить их на найденное значение. Например, 1 2 0 4 5 7 0 – 1 2 2 4 5 7 2 Массив обьявил, а задание не пойму. Помогите кто чем может. #include <cstdlib> подробнее

Показать сообщение отдельно
kazak
3033 / 2354 / 155
Регистрация: 11.03.2009
Сообщений: 5,401
26.12.2010, 12:08     С++ бинарные файлы
Цитата Сообщение от eczo Посмотреть сообщение
надеюсь вам эти ключи помогут
Нет, не помогут, это для Си.

Цитата Сообщение от Perfaratar Посмотреть сообщение
А вот команды не помню. Напомните пожалуйста.
http://cplusplus.com/reference/iostream/fstream/open/
И читать бинарный файл лучше read/write'ом
http://cplusplus.com/reference/iostream/istream/read/
http://cplusplus.com/reference/iostream/ostream/write/

Цитата Сообщение от Perfaratar Посмотреть сообщение
И ещё после выполнения задачи нужно освободить память от динамического массива.
Цитата Сообщение от Perfaratar Посмотреть сообщение
C++
1
2
3
4
int **mat=NULL;
mat=new int*[q];
for(int i=0;i<q;i++)
   mat[i]=new int[q];
C++
1
2
3
for (int i = 0; i < q; i++)
   delete [] mat[i];
delete [] mat;
 
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ru